Subject: RE: DOCBOOK: page numbers in TOC
Carlos Eduardo Selonke de Souza writes: > <graphic align=center fileref="image001.jpg"></graphic> ... > How can I get the image inside the page in pdf versions? scale the image file itself, or use whatever attribute Docbook provides to scale the image .. > Reading the foo.log I found this. > <-- > <use image001.jpg> > Overfull \hbox (204.33096pt too wide) detected at line 562 so, image001.jpg is wider than the page. > My foo.pdf have cross references, the only problem is that the > cross references are inside a red box, like a html link. write a file called jadetex.cfg containing \hypersetup{colorlinks, linkcolor=black} and see if it has any effect Sebastian
